wind-powered

[US]/[wɪnd ˈpaʊ.ərd]/
[UK]/[wɪnd ˈpaʊ.ərd]/
Frequency: Very High

Translation

n.A device or system that is powered by the wind.
adj.Driven or operated by the power of the wind.; Using wind as a source of energy.
